Why Mail-Order Dryer Vent Cleaning Tools Often Fail
Most DIY dryer vent kits use flexible rods that spin when connected to a drill. While this design may work in short, straight vents, real-world dryer vent systems rarely follow a simple path.
Longer Dryer Vent Lines Common in Savannah Increase Tool Failure
Many homes in Savannah, Pooler, and surrounding coastal areas have dryer vents that run through crawl spaces, up interior walls, or toward roof exits. These vent lines often exceed 25 feet and include multiple turns, making it easy for a dryer vent cleaning tool to get stuck during use.
Tight Bends and Aging Ductwork Catch DIY Cleaning Tools
In older Savannah homes, dryer vents may include sharp elbows, rigid metal seams, or aging duct sections. DIY rods are not designed to handle these conditions and can easily snag, twist, or break apart inside the vent.
Drill-Powered Cleaning Causes Rod Separation
Mail-order kits rely on spinning force rather than controlled airflow. Excess drill speed can cause rods to disconnect suddenly, allowing the brush head and broken sections to lodge deeper inside the vent line.
Lint and Moisture Accelerate Blockage Formation
Savannah’s humid climate contributes to heavier lint accumulation inside dryer vents. When a tool becomes stuck, lint and moisture quickly cling to it, creating a dense blockage that worsens with every dryer cycle.

What Happens When a Cleaning Tool Gets Stuck in the Dryer Vent
A stuck DIY dryer vent tool creates multiple risks inside the system.
- Restricted Airflow and Heavy Lint Compaction: Airflow drops significantly as lint builds tightly around the lodged tool.
- Overheating and Reduced Dryer Performance: Blocked vents force the dryer to run longer and hotter, increasing wear on internal components.
- Moist Air Backflow Into the Home: A clogged dryer vent can push humid air back into the laundry space, contributing to condensation and mold risk.
- Elevated Dryer Fire Hazard: Lint is highly flammable, and a trapped cleaning tool surrounded by lint dramatically increases fire danger.
- Damage to Dryer Vent Ducting: Pulling forcefully on a stuck tool often tears or disconnects vent sections hidden behind walls or ceilings.
What to Do Immediately If a DIY Dryer Vent Tool Gets Stuck
If a mail-order dryer vent cleaning tool becomes lodged, take these steps right away:
- Turn off the dryer to prevent overheating
- Stop using the drill or attempting to spin the tool
- Check for warm or humid air backing into the laundry area
- Keep the dryer off until a professional inspection is completed
These actions help reduce further damage and safety risks.
What Not to Do When a Dryer Vent Cleaning Tool Is Stuck
Avoid these common mistakes:
- Pulling hard on the rods
- Reconnecting the drill and spinning again
- Inserting hooks, wires, or sharp objects
- Attempting to access the vent through walls or ceilings
- Continuing to operate the dryer
These actions often worsen the blockage and increase repair costs.
